
Pillsbury Bread Rolls: Hard Roll Dough and Kaiser Roll Dough
General Mills recalls Pillsbury Bread Rolls dough (Hard and Kaiser) over possible glass contamination.
Do not consume the recalled dough. Return it to the place of purchase for a full refund, or discard it. For questions, contact General Mills at 1-800-248-7310.
Why it was recalled
General Mills is recalling Pillsbury Bread Rolls, Hard Roll Dough and Kaiser Roll Dough due to potential foreign material (glass) contamination. The affected products include 180-count packages of Hard Roll Dough (2.25 oz each) and 144-count packages of Kaiser Roll Dough (2.5 oz each). Consumers should not consume the product and should return it to the place of purchase for a refund.
Is mine affected?
Check the lot code and best-by (or expiration) date printed on your package. Yours is affected if it matches one below.
| Product | Lot code | NDC / UPC | Recall # |
|---|---|---|---|
| Pillsbury Bread Rolls, Hard Roll Dough. 180 units / 2.25oz each. Net Wt. 25.31 lb (11.48kg) Package | 11JUN6JL, 12JUN6JL | UPC 721582-13283 4, UPC 107-21582-13283-1 | H-1154-2026 |
| Pillsbury Bread Rolls, Kaiser Roll Dough. 144 units / 2.5oz each. Net Wt. 22.5 lb (10.2kg) Package | 12JUN6JL | UPC 7 21582-13288 9, UPC 107-21582-13288-6 | H-1155-2026 |
Where it was sold
Distributed in Arkansas, California, Florida, Georgia, Indiana, Louisiana, Maine, Missouri, New Mexico, New York, Ohio, Oklahoma, Pennsylvania, South Carolina, Tennessee, Texas, Virginia, Washington, and Wyoming.
